ETYM Latin, the hair which appears on the body at puberty, from pubes adult.
Lower abdominal region; hair growing in that region.
The lower part of the abdomen just above the external genital organs; SYN. pubic region, loins.

Lowest part of the front of the human trunk, the region where the external generative organs are situated. The underlying bony structure, the pubic arch, is formed by the union in the midline of the two pubic bones, which are the front portions of the hip bones. In women this is more prominent than in men, to allow more room for the passage of the child’s head at birth, and it carries a pad of fat and connective tissue, the mons veneris (mount of Venus), for its protection.
